Wood clad windows installation involves replacing or upgrading existing windows with models that feature a wood exterior finish. This service typically includes removing old windows, preparing the window openings, and carefully installing new wood clad units to ensure proper fit and function. The process may also involve sealing and insulating around the new windows to improve energy efficiency and prevent drafts. Skilled contractors focus on achieving a seamless appearance that enhances both the aesthetic appeal and the durability of the windows, making them a popular choice for homeowners seeking a natural, timeless look for their property.
One of the primary reasons homeowners seek wood clad window installation is to address issues related to aging or damaged windows. Over time, windows may become drafty, difficult to open or close, or suffer from wood rot and deterioration due to exposure to weather. Installing new wood clad windows can help solve these problems by providing a sturdy, weather-resistant exterior while maintaining the classic look of natural wood. Additionally, new installations can improve energy efficiency, helping to reduce heating and cooling costs by providing better insulation and sealing gaps that allow air leaks.

The overview below groups typical Wood Clad Windows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Encinitas,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ood clad window repairs or replacements range from $250-$600, covering tasks like sash replacement or seal repairs.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end. Local contractors can often handle these efficiently and affordably.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ard wood clad window us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000 per window, depending on size, style, and materials. Most projects in Encinitas tend to land in this range, with larger or more customized windows pushing costs upward.
Full Window Installation - Full installation of multiple wood clad windows for a home can range from $8,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on the number of windows and complexity of the project. Larger, more complex homes or custom designs can increase the overall cost significantly.
Complex or Custom Projects - High-end or intricate projects, such as large custom wood clad windows or historic home restorations, can exceed $25,000. These projects are less common and typically involve specialized craftsmanship and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are wood clad windows? Wood clad windows combine a wood interior with a durable exterior material, providing both aesthetic appeal and weather resistance for homes in Encinitas, CA.
How do local contractors install wood clad windows? Experienced service providers typically measure, prepare the opening, and carefully install the window units to ensure proper fit and function.
Are wood clad windows suitable for coastal environments like Encinitas? Yes, many local contractors recommend wood clad windows for coastal areas due to their durability and ability to withstand moisture when properly maintained.
What maintenance is required for wood clad windows? Regular inspections, cleaning, and occasional touch-ups of the interior wood finish help maintain the appearance and performance of wood clad windows.
